Best Area to Stay in Sorrento: Ultimate Guide to Top Places and Tips

The best areas to stay in Sorrento are Piazza Tasso and Marina Piccola, which offer scenic views and easy access to restaurants. Marina Grande and the Old Town provide a charming experience. For budget options, check out Sant’Agnello or Priora. Each area uniquely enhances your stay in Sorrento.

For those seeking stunning views, the cliffs overlooking the Bay of Naples are perfect. This area features luxury hotels and breathtaking sunsets. Staying here also provides easy access to the waterfront, where ferries can take you to nearby islands like Capri.

If you prioritize tranquility, the neighborhood of Sant’Agnello is an excellent option. It is peaceful and family-friendly, yet still close to Sorrento’s main attractions. Many boutique hotels and guesthouses are available in this area, offering a unique experience.

Where Should You Stay in Sorrento for an Active Nightlife?

For an active nightlife in Sorrento, you should stay in the historic center. This area features a variety of bars, clubs, and restaurants. The lively atmosphere attracts both locals and tourists. You can easily access popular nightlife spots like the Piazza Tasso. Additionally, many venues host live music and events. Staying here allows for a convenient walking distance to entertainment options. Consider choosing accommodations like hotels or apartments in this area for the best experience.

  6. Old Town:
    The Old Town of Sorrento is a historical area rich in culture and attractions. It features narrow streets lined with shops, cafés, and restaurants. Visitors can explore the charming architecture and local artisan shops. The Cathedral of Sorrento is a significant landmark found in this area.

  7. Marina Grande:
    Marina Grande is the fishing harbor and beach area of Sorrento. It offers beautiful views of the sea and is close to several seafood restaurants. Tourists can catch boat trips to neighboring islands and enjoy the beach ambience. This area is also where traditional fishing practices can be observed.

  8. Piazza Tasso:
    Piazza Tasso serves as the main square in Sorrento. It is a bustling hub filled with shops and cafés. Visitors often enjoy people-watching in this lively area. Events and festivals frequently take place here, showcasing local culture and traditions.

  9. Sant’Antonino Church:
    Sant’Antonino Church, dedicated to the patron saint of Sorrento, features stunning Baroque architecture. The church is located near the Old Town and is easily accessible for visitors. It holds historical significance, with origins dating back to the 11th century.

  10. Sorrento Peninsula:
    The Sorrento Peninsula offers breathtaking landscapes and panoramic views. Visitors can explore hiking trails and coastal paths, leading to hidden coves and stunning vistas. The area is known for its citrus groves and picturesque villages, like Positano and Amalfi.

  1. Sant’Agnello:
    Sant’Agnello is a charming suburb located just a short walk from Sorrento. This area offers budget-friendly guesthouses and hostels. Travelers can enjoy local restaurants that serve affordable traditional dishes. The area also provides excellent access to public transport, allowing easy day trips to nearby attractions. For many, Sant’Agnello combines affordability with convenience.

  2. Meta:
    Meta is a coastal village slightly farther from Sorrento. It features lower accommodation prices and beautiful beaches, making it attractive for budget travelers. The village is less crowded, allowing for a more authentic Italian experience. Travelers appreciate the local markets and eateries, which offer delicious food at reasonable prices. The stunning seaside views add value to the overall experience.

  3. Sorrento Town Center:
    The Sorrento Town Center is vibrant and bustling, with a variety of shops, restaurants, and attractions. While accommodation can be more expensive, there are still budget-friendly options available. Its central location means easy access to attractions like the Marina and Piazza Tasso. Visitors enjoy the lively atmosphere, especially during the evening when the town comes alive with entertainment.

  4. Marina Grande:
    Marina Grande is a picturesque fishing village. It features waterfront accommodations that can be affordable, especially during the off-peak season. Travelers can enjoy fresh seafood at local restaurants without breaking the bank. The quaint charm and stunning views of the bay provide a unique experience that many budget travelers appreciate.

  5. Colli di Fontanelle:
    Colli di Fontanelle is a hillside area offering stunning views of the Bay of Naples. It provides budget-friendly accommodation and is perfect for nature lovers. The area features hiking trails and is ideal for those looking to escape the bustling towns. However, it’s essential for travelers to note that public transport options may be limited.

How Can You Choose the Perfect Area to Stay in Sorrento Based on Your Travel Style?

To choose the perfect area to stay in Sorrento based on your travel style, consider your preferences for activities, accessibility, ambiance, and budget.

  1. Activities: Assess the activities that interest you.
    – If you enjoy beach activities, opt for accommodations near Marina Piccola. This area offers easy access to beaches and water sports.
    – For cultural experiences, consider staying in the historic center. It provides proximity to attractions like the Cathedral of Sorrento and local artisan shops.

  2. Accessibility: Evaluate your need for transportation.
    – If you plan to explore the Amalfi Coast, select an area near the Sorrento train station. This location enables convenient train travel to Naples and other coastal towns.
    – For those preferring a quieter experience, accommodations in the hills offer scenic views but might require car rental or more extensive walking.

  3. Ambiance: Determine the atmosphere you desire.
    – For a lively social scene, stay in the bustling downtown area. This zone features numerous bars, restaurants, and shops.
    – If you seek tranquility, choose a location in the surrounding countryside or nearby villages. These areas provide a peaceful retreat with beautiful landscapes.

  4. Budget: Analyze your financial limits.
    – For affordable options, consider guesthouses or hostels in less touristy areas. These accommodations provide comfort at a lower cost.
    – If you have a higher budget, luxury hotels or villas along the coastline offer stunning views and premium amenities.
